Welcome to this lovingly maintained 1989 mobile home, where thoughtful updates, practical luxuries, and plenty of personality come together on approximately 0.26 acres at the end of a quiet cul-de-sac. Step inside and prepare to be pleasantly surprised. The open floor plan creates an easy flow between the kitchen and living room, with the upper kitchen cabinets intentionally removed to preserve the view and keep the space feeling open and connected. Because apparently, even kitchens deserve a little drama-free sightline. And the updates? Plenty. The home has been treated to fresh interior paint throughout, new carpet, new vinyl flooring in the kitchen, and new vinyl flooring in the guest bathroom. The primary suite has received a proper little makeover of its own, with a remodeled bathroom featuring a new vanity, new flooring, fresh paint, and a new shower. There’s even a new oven waiting in the kitchen, while the washer and dryer stay, because sometimes luxury is simply not having to buy one more thing! Then we arrive at the part that may have you saying, “Now THAT is smart.” Out back sits a garage/workshop with its very own full bathroom, giving you a dedicated space for projects, tools, equipment, hobbies, or whatever your version of tinkering happens to be. And the pièce de résistance? An elevated wash tub designed to let you clean tools, equipment, muddy treasures, or garden finds without bending over until your back starts negotiating terms. Even the pups will enjoy this luxury. The additional garage space connected to the house provides plenty of room for the mower, tools, implements, and all those things that somehow multiply when you own property. Outside, the VIP treatment continues. Enjoy your morning coffee from the enclosed front porch, park comfortably beneath the carport, and head toward the back of the property where the scenery gets decidedly more private. The wooded backyard has no rear neighbors, giving you a peaceful backdrop and a little breathing room. Fruit trees have already been planted, because apparently someone had the foresight to think about dessert. And above it all? A metal roof adds durability and peace of mind, while city water and a water filtration system take care of the essentials. This isn't about flashy square footage or showing off for the neighbors.
